In more than ten countries around the world, The Knot Worldwide champions the power of celebration. Our global family of brands provide best-in-class products, services and content to take celebration planning from inspiration to action. At the core of our business is our industry-leading global online wedding Vendor Marketplace, connecting couples with local wedding professionals and a comprehensive suite of personalized wedding websites, planning tools, invitations, and registry services that make wedding planning easier for couples around the globe. Each year, we connect more than 4.5 million users with around 900,000 global small businesses through our Vendor Marketplace.

ABOUT THE ROLE AND OUR TEAM

Are you a strategic sales professional ready to drive growth in a high-impact category? The Venue Account Executive is responsible for hitting monthly sales goals by engaging with wedding professionals in our Venue and Catering categories across the United States. Using a high-volume cold calling approach and a consultative sales process, you will build rapport with business owners to advise them on industry trends and how to scale their brands through The Knot and WeddingWire’s premium advertising platforms.

The Venue category requires a high level of sales maturity and the ability to navigate a longer, more complex sales cycle. Because high-impact outreach and client consultations happen when wedding professionals are most active, success in this role requires a dedicated 40-hour-per-week commitment during our standard business hours of 9:00 am – 6:00 pm EST. We are looking for professionals who understand that consistent presence is the key to managing a successful pipeline.

Applications for this role are being accepted on a rolling basis.

This is a fully remote role. We are currently hiring candidates who reside within our established U.S. hiring hubs, including the DC area (Maryland, Delaware, Virginia, D.C.), New York, New Jersey, Philadelphia, Texas, Indiana, Georgia, North Carolina, and Florida.
